Современный бизнес требует постоянного анализа больших объемов данных для принятия обоснованных решений. Одним из эффективных инструментов для обработки и визуализации данных стала платформа Visiology. Она позволяет компаниям получать ценные инсайты, необходимые для повышения эффективности процессов и оптимизации затрат.
Одной из наиболее распространенных систем автоматизации предприятий в России является 1С, и интеграция этих двух платформ открывает новые возможности для эффективного управления бизнесом.
В данной статье мы подробно рассмотрим процесс интеграции Visiology с 1С, используя решения от компании Денвик Аналитика — Экстрактор 1С, DCC Connector и специальный инструмент Visiology Connector.
Что такое Visiology?
Visiology — это облачная аналитическая платформа, предназначенная для сбора, хранения и анализа больших объемов данных. Платформа позволяет создавать интерактивные дашборды, отчёты и панели мониторинга, обеспечивая быстрый доступ к важной информации для руководителей всех уровней.
Преимущества Visiology:
- Возможность интеграции с различными источниками данных.
- Удобный интерфейс для построения отчетов и аналитики.
- Поддержка машинного обучения и предиктивной аналитики.
- Безопасность и защита данных.
Инструменты интеграции
Компания Денвик Аналитика разработала специальные инструменты для интеграции Visiology с системой 1С:
- Экстрактор 1С: Программный модуль, позволяющий извлекать данные из базы 1С и передавать их в систему Visiology.
- DCC Connector: Коннектор, обеспечивающий двустороннюю связь между системами, позволяя обновлять данные в обоих направлениях.
- Visiology Connector: Специальный компонент, упрощающий настройку взаимодействия между Visiology и 1С.
Установка и настройка интеграционного инструмента
Процесс установки интеграционного модуля состоит из нескольких простых шагов:
- Пользователь получает уникальный лицензионный ключ от Visiology.
- Запускает установку программы и вводит полученный ключ.
- Система автоматически устанавливает компоненты, проверяя лицензию.
- Создается подключение к базе данных Visiology.
Способы подключения к данным
Существует два основных способа подключения к базе данных Visiology:
- Adobe DB-прокси: Этот метод обеспечивает удалённый доступ к базам данных через прокси-сервер, защищенный средствами Adobe.
- Native API:
Прямой доступ к серверам Visiology осуществляется через нативный
API-интерфейс, предоставляющий полный контроль над передачей данных.
Важно отметить, что выбор способа подключения влияет на безопасность и
производительность системы. Необходимо учитывать особенности
инфраструктуры предприятия и требования информационной безопасности.
Шаг 1: Установка Visiology
- Загрузка установочного файла: Перейдите на официальный сайт Visiology и загрузите последнюю версию инсталлятора.
- Запуск установщика: Запустите загруженный файл и следуйте инструкциям мастера установки.
- Активация лицензии:
После завершения установки введите лицензионный ключ, полученный при
покупке или тестовом доступе. Это активирует полный доступ ко всем
функциям платформы.
Шаг 2: Получение логина и пароля
- Регистрация аккаунта: Если у вас ещё нет аккаунта, зарегистрируйтесь на сайте Visiology, указав своё имя, электронную почту и создав пароль.
- Получение учетных данных: После регистрации вам будут отправлены логин и пароль на указанный адрес электронной почты.
- Авторизация: Используйте полученные данные для входа в платформу.
Шаг 3: Подключение к API
- Настройка соединения: В разделе настроек найдите пункт "API Connection" и выберите "New Connection".
- Ввод данных хоста: Укажите адрес сервера API, который предоставил ваш администратор или команда поддержки Visiology.
- Создание базы данных: Нажмите "Create Database" для инициализации базы данных на сервере Ozgard.
- Подтверждение подключения: Проверьте успешность подключения, проверив возвращаемые данные для подключения к базе данных.
Эти шаги помогут вам успешно установить и настроить Visiology для вашего
проекта. Если возникнут дополнительные вопросы или проблемы, обратитесь в
службу поддержки Visiology.
Для интеграции системы Visiology с вашей информационной системой на
платформе 1С необходимо выполнить ряд шагов, которые включают установку
специального коннектора и настройку параметров подключения. Вот
подробная инструкция по подключению экстрактора к Visiology:
Установка коннектора
- Получение и установка коннектора:Скачайте установочный файл коннектора для вашей версии 1С.
Запустите инсталлятор и следуйте инструкциям мастера установки. - Настройка конфигурации:Откройте конфигурацию 1С и перейдите в раздел администрирования.
Найдите пункт меню "Интеграция с Visiology" и выберите его.
Укажите путь к файлу лицензии и введите полученные реквизиты (логин, пароль).
Настройка подключения
Через ODBC-драйвер (Windows)
- Установка драйвера:Установите ODBC драйвер для PostgreSQL на вашем компьютере.
- Создание источника данных:Перейдите в Панель управления → Администрирование → Источники данных (ODBC).
Создайте новый источник данных, выбрав драйвер PostgreSQL.
Укажите хост, базу данных, логин и пароль. - Проверка соединения:Проверьте соединение, нажав кнопку "Тест".
Через DBC-прокси (все ОС)
- Запуск прокси-сервера:Загрузите архив с DBC-прокси и распакуйте его.
Запустите исполняемый файл dbc-proxy.exe (или соответствующий файл для вашей операционной системы). - Конфигурация прокси:Отредактируйте файл config.json, указав там необходимые настройки (хост, база данных, логин, пароль).
- Регистрация подключения в DCC:Войдите в центр управления (DCC) с правами администратора.
Зарегистрируйте новое подключение, указав реквизиты и тип подключения (ODBC или DBC-прокси).
Режимы передачи данных
Вы можете выбрать один из трех режимов передачи данных:
- API-интерфейс: Используйте RESTful API для отправки запросов и получения данных.
- Native API: Этот режим позволяет напрямую обращаться к базам данных PostgreSQL.
- DBC-прокси: Передача данных через промежуточный прокси-сервер, поддерживающий работу на любых операционных системах.
Важные моменты
- Все данные передаются непосредственно на сервера Visiology.
- Регистрация
подключения обязательна для запуска проектов и мониторинга их
состояния. Подключение необходимо зарегистрировать в DCC (центре
управления) для выполнения проектов и отслеживания их статуса.
Следуя данным рекомендациям, вы сможете успешно интегрировать систему
Visiology с вашим приложением 1С и начать эффективно анализировать
данные.
Интеграция Denvic Control Center (DCC) и Visiology представляет собой значительный шаг вперед в области обработки и анализа корпоративных данных. Эта интеграция позволяет компаниям эффективно управлять своими ресурсами и повышать качество принятия решений благодаря улучшенному доступу к данным и упрощению процессов аналитики.
Настройка подключения
Процесс настройки подключения начинается с регистрации экстрактора в системе Visiology. Пользователь получает уникальный пароль, который используется для аутентификации и предоставления доступа к ресурсам. После успешной регистрации система настраивается таким образом, чтобы обеспечить бесперебойное взаимодействие между различными компонентами
инфраструктуры.
Шаги настройки:
- Регистрация экстрактора: Пользователь вводит полученные учетные данные (логин и пароль).
- Выбор базы данных: Система автоматически определяет и сохраняет имя выбранной базы данных.
- Установка коннектора: Коннектор устанавливается на клиентской стороне, обеспечивая связь с серверной частью.
- Подключение к системе: Пользователь авторизуется и подключается к выбранным базам данных.
Эта процедура гарантирует, что все необходимые компоненты интегрированы и
готовы к работе, позволяя пользователям быстро получать доступ к
необходимой информации.
Преимущества интеграции DCC и Visiology
- Повышение эффективности: Упрощение процесса сбора и анализа данных снижает временные затраты и повышает производительность сотрудников.
- Безопасность: Использование защищенных каналов связи обеспечивает защиту конфиденциальной информации.
- Масштабируемость: Возможность масштабирования системы позволяет адаптироваться к росту объемов данных и расширению бизнеса.
- Удобство использования: Простота настройки и эксплуатации делают систему доступной даже для пользователей с минимальным уровнем технических знаний.
Таким образом, интеграция DCC и Visiology открывает новые возможности для
компаний, стремящихся оптимизировать процессы управления данными и
повысить эффективность своей деятельности.
Регистрация Коннектора
Шаги регистрации коннектора в Центре Управления
- Создание базы данныхКомпания создает необходимую базу данных на сервере Visiology, используя PostgreSQL.
- Получение необходимых данныхПосле создания базы компания получает всю необходимую информацию о конфигурации и параметрах системы.
- Настройка коннектораИспользуя полученные данные, выполняется настройка коннектора для интеграции с центром управления.
Коннектор оптимизирует процессы, ускоряет обработку данных и повышает точность результатов.
История выполнения проекта
Команды для проекта
Проекты в рамка DCC центра управления.
Есть несколько способов, через которые можно выгружать данные:
1. ODBC-компоненты
ODBC (Open Database Connectivity) — стандартный интерфейс для
подключения приложений к базам данных. Этот метод предполагает установку
драйвера на сервере, который обеспечивает передачу данных между разными
системами. Существует два варианта реализации:
- ODBC-компонент: Устанавливается непосредственно на сервер и связывается с приложением для отправки данных.
- Visiology-коннектор: Использует ODBC-драйвер для связи с базой данных, обеспечивая передачу данных через промежуточный слой.
2. DBI-прокси
DBI-прокси представляет собой прокси-сервер, работающий в локальной сети. Основные особенности:
- Прокси является единым каналом передачи данных для разных компонентов системы.
- Используется как универсальное решение для взаимодействия визуализатора-контекста и местного компонента экстрактора.
- Упрощает управление потоками данных и снижает нагрузку на инфраструктуру.
3. Netiva API
Netiva API интегрирован прямо в состав экстрактора и развертывается на сервере вместе с ним. Его ключевые преимущества:
- Компактность и простота установки благодаря встроенности в сам экстрактор.
- Полностью автоматизированная передача данных без дополнительного конфигурирования сторонних сервисов.
Выбор метода зависит от конкретных требований проекта и инфраструктуры организации.
Интеграция решений типа Visiology с системой 1С значительно повышает эффективность аналитики и принятия управленческих решений.
Однако важно учитывать специфику своей среды и возможные ограничения при выборе конкретного подхода.
Для грамотной реализации и оптимизации рекомендуется обращаться к профессионалам в сфере IT-технологий.
Пример формирования набора данных в визиолоджи:
Экстрактор: что это и как он работает?
Экстрактор — это инструмент, который позволяет извлекать данные из различных источников.
В контексте работы с 1С экстрактор может использоваться для выгрузки информации в другие системы.
Пошаговый процесс работы экстрактора:
Установка расширений в 1С.
Прежде чем начать работу, необходимо установить соответствующие
расширения в системе 1С. Это позволит экстрактору получить доступ к
нужным данным.
Настройка проекта.
После установки расширений необходимо настроить проект, указав
параметры выгрузки. Это включает в себя выбор таблиц, полей и других
параметров.
База хранилища.
После настройки проекта экстрактор создаёт базу хранилища, в которую
будут выгружаться данные. Это может быть база данных, файловая система
или другой источник хранения информации.
Сложности выгрузки данных из 1С
Выгрузка данных из 1С действительно является непростой задачей из-за специфики архитектуры самой системы. Рассмотрим подробнее причины и пути
преодоления этих трудностей.
Основные трудности:
- Особенности структуры базы данных:
Данные хранятся в специализированной структуре, которая отличается от
стандартных реляционных моделей. Это требует специальных подходов к
извлечению и обработке данных. - Необходимость ручных операций:
Часто приходится создавать дополнительные скрипты или процедуры для
извлечения нужных данных, особенно если требуются нестандартные выборки. - Отсутствие универсальных решений:
Различные версии 1С имеют разные подходы к хранению и представлению
данных, что затрудняет создание единого подхода для всех случаев.
Современные решения
Для устранения указанных трудностей разработаны специализированные
инструменты и технологии, позволяющие упростить процесс выгрузки данных
из 1С. Вот некоторые из них:
1. Интеграция через API
Современные версии 1С предоставляют возможности взаимодействия через
RESTful API, позволяя легко извлекать необходимые данные программными
средствами.
2. Использование специализированных коннекторов
Существуют готовые коннекторы и интеграционные модули, такие как
"Visiology Connector", которые позволяют подключаться непосредственно к
данным 1С и производить их обработку и преобразование.
3. Создание настраиваемых отчетов и выгрузок Экстрактором 1С
Через встроенные механизмы формирования отчетов в 1С можно настроить
автоматическое формирование необходимых файлов выгрузки через Экстрактор
1С.
Преимущества новых технологий
Переход на современные технологии позволяет значительно повысить эффективность обработки данных из 1С:
- Повышение скорости и точности передачи данных благодаря прямым соединениям и автоматизации процесса.
- Снижение нагрузки на сотрудников, поскольку ручной труд заменяется автоматизированными инструментами.
- Возможность анализа больших объемов данных в режиме реального времени.
Таким образом, использование современных инструментов существенно улучшает качество и скорость работы с данными из 1С, обеспечивая компаниям
конкурентные преимущества в условиях цифровой экономики.
Visiology Dashboards — это мощный инструмент для визуализации данных, который позволяет создавать интерактивные панели мониторинга (дашборды).
Давайте рассмотрим ключевые возможности и преимущества модуля Visiology Dashboards подробнее.
Основные характеристики
Конструктор дашбордов
Конструктор обеспечивает интуитивно понятный интерфейс для построения панелей мониторинга. Вы можете легко добавлять элементы интерфейса, настраивать отображение данных и изменять макеты страниц.
Шаблоны
Модуль включает библиотеку готовых шаблонов, позволяющих быстро создать
профессиональные дашборды без необходимости начинать с нуля. Эти шаблоны покрывают широкий спектр отраслей и бизнес-задач.
Маркетплейс виджетов
Маркетплейс предоставляет доступ к большому количеству специализированных виджетов, разработанных сторонними поставщиками. Это расширяет функциональность ваших дашбордов и позволяет интегрировать дополнительные инструменты анализа.
Гибкая настройка аналитики
Система поддерживает адаптивную настройку аналитических процессов, позволяя пользователям выбирать наиболее удобные методы анализа данных и
представлять их в удобочитаемом виде.
Преимущества использования Visiology Dashboards
- Простота освоения:
Благодаря простоте интерфейса и наличию подробной документации обучение работе с модулем занимает минимальное количество времени. - Интерактивность: Возможность взаимодействия с данными прямо на панелях мониторинга значительно упрощает процесс принятия решений.
- Масштабируемость:
Модуль способен обрабатывать большие объемы данных и поддерживать
высокую производительность даже при большом количестве пользователей. - Безопасность: Данные надежно защищены благодаря встроенным механизмам аутентификации и шифрования.
Таким образом, Visiology Dashboards является отличным решением для компаний, стремящихся эффективно визуализировать и анализировать свои данные, обеспечивая прозрачность и доступность информации для всех
заинтересованных лиц.
Для эффективного размещения данных из разных источников в ClickHouse
действительно важно учитывать взаимосвязи таблиц и структуру модели
данных.
Ниже приведены шаги и рекомендации по оптимизации размещения данных в ClickHouse:
Шаги по размещению данных
- Анализ структуры данныхОпределите типы данных и размер каждой таблицы.
Проанализируйте поля связи и их типы (например, первичные ключи, внешние ключи). - Выбор оптимальной схемы храненияИспользуйте подходящие движки таблиц (MergeTree, ReplicatedMergeTree и др.) в зависимости от объема данных и требований к производительности.
Рассмотрите использование партиционирования для больших таблиц, чтобы ускорить запросы. - Оптимизация запросовСоздавайте индексы на часто используемые столбцы.
Использовать материализованные представления для агрегаций и сложных вычислений. - Масштабирование и репликацияНастройте кластеры и реплики для повышения доступности и отказоустойчивости.
Убедитесь, что шардирование настроено правильно, чтобы равномерно распределять нагрузку. - Мониторинг и поддержкаРегулярно проверяйте производительность системы и вносите необходимые изменения.
Следите за использованием ресурсов сервера и оптимизируйте конфигурацию при необходимости.
Рекомендации по оптимизации
- Партиционирование:
Разделяйте большие таблицы на части по определенным критериям
(например, по дате). Это значительно ускоряет выполнение запросов. - Индексирование: Создавайте вторичные индексы на важные столбцы, чтобы ускорять выборки.
- Материализованные представления: Используйте их для предварительной обработки данных и ускорения регулярных отчетов.
- Агрегационные запросы: Применяйте агрегатные функции и группировки для уменьшения размера возвращаемых данных.
- Ограничение SELECT-запросов: Всегда ограничивайте количество выбираемых строк с помощью оператора LIMIT.
Следуя этим рекомендациям, вы сможете обеспечить эффективное хранение и
обработку данных в ClickHouse даже при изменении модели данных
пользователями Visiology.
Интеграция данных — это не просто техническая задача, а важный аспект управления информацией в компании.
Понимание принципов работы экстракторов и других инструментов позволяет
оптимизировать процессы и повысить эффективность работы с данными.